Earth Hour is a WWF initiative to invite individuals, businesses, governments and communities to turn off the lights for an hour as the action in support of climate change. There are 1508 large and small cities in 80 countries participated. </span><p style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old">Earth Hour in 2008 developed into a sustainable global movement with 50 million people turn off the lights. Global Landmarks such as the Golden Gate Bridge in San Francisco, Rome’s Colosseum, the Sydney Opera House and the Coca Cola billboards in Times Square all stood in darkness.<span id="more-450"></span></p><p style="FONT-WEIGHT: bold">Earth Hour 2009 targets 1 billion people turn off their lights as part of a global voice.
